Bone Marrow Stem Cell
Bone marrow stem cells are collected from your own body, typically from the hip bone, using a minimally invasive procedure. These stem cells are rich in regenerative potential and can develop into a variety of tissue types, making them effective for repairing damaged joints, cartilage, tendons, ligaments, and bone. Once processed, the cells are precisely injected into the injured or degenerated area to stimulate healing, reduce inflammation, and restore function.
Adipose Derived Tissue
Adipose (fat) tissue, usually taken from the waist, contains a high concentration of mesenchymal stem cells. These cells are known for their strong regenerative and anti-inflammatory properties. After gentle extraction and processing, the adipose-derived stem cells are delivered to targeted areas to promote tissue repair, improve joint health, and reduce chronic pain — all using your body’s own natural healing potential.

What is the difference between PRP and stem cells?
Both PRP (Platelet-Rich Plasma) and stem cell therapy use your body’s natural healing abilities, but they work in different ways. PRP is made from your blood and contains growth factors that speed up healing. Stem cells can actually turn into different types of cells your body needs, such as cartilage, muscle, or tendon cells, to repair damage and restore function.
